# Service Accounts & Build Agent Clock Skew

Welcome aboard! Quick gotcha for new folks: our Brindlewick build agents drift a few seconds apart, and the Tockmaster token validator rejects anything more than 30s off. If your service-account auth randomly fails on agent-07, that's almost always skew, not a bad credential. Run the NTP sync task before blaming the key. The service account itself authenticates against the Lanternfeed API, and for local testing you'll want the key below.

service key, fawip-bajef: kto11_Qt5wZK9vdNC

Quick note for reviewers: per-tenant rate quotas in Quillgate are enforced at the edge, not in the app tier, so don't go hunting for throttle logic in the handlers. The quota table lives in the Fernwick config store and syncs every 90 seconds. If a tenant complains about 429s, check the sync lag first — it's almost always that. The quota snapshot used for this rollout is pinned to the token below.

build token for kahop-kagep: htk6_72fc45

## Retrying Failed Exports

When Ledgerwing export jobs fail, the retry daemon re-queues them up to the limit in `EXPORT_MAX_RETRIES` (default 3), with backoff controlled by `EXPORT_BACKOFF_SECONDS`. Retries call the Ostrel archive service, which authenticates every request. Before enabling retries locally, add this line to your `.env` so the daemon can sign its requests:

sealed setting: ARCHIVE_KEY3=8d0